PRODUCT DESCRIPTION
The AD8114/AD8115 are high speed 16 × 16 video crosspoint switch matrices. They offer a –3 dB signal bandwidth greater than 200 MHz and channel switch times of less than 50 ns with 1% settling. With –70 dB of crosstalk and –90 dB isolation (@ 5 MHz), the AD8114/AD8115 are useful in many high speed applications. The differential gain and differential phase of better than 0.05% and 0.05° respectively, along with 0.1 dB flatness out to 25 MHz while driving a 75 Ω back-terminated load, make the AD8114/AD8115 ideal for all types of signal switching.
FEATURES
16 x 16 High Speed Nonblocking Switch Arrays
AD8114; G = +1
AD8115; G = +2
Serial or Parallel Programming of Switch Array
Serial Data Out Allows “Daisy Chaining” of Multiple
16 x 16s to Create Larger Switch Arrays
High Impedance Output Disable Allows Connection of
Multiple Devices Without Loading the Output Bus
For Smaller Arrays See Our AD8108/AD8109 (8 3 8) or
AD8110/AD8111 (16 x 8) Switch Arrays
Complete Solution
Buffered Inputs
Programmable High Impedance Outputs
16 Output Amplifiers, AD8114 (G = +1), AD8115 (G = +2)
Drives 150 Ω Loads
Excellent Video Performance
25 MHz, 0.1 dB Gain Flatness
0.05%/0.05° Differential Gain/Differential Phase Error
(RL = 150 Ω)
Excellent AC Performance
–3 dB Bandwidth: 225 MHz
Slew Rate: 375 V/μs
Low Power of 700 mW (2.75 mW per Point)
Low All Hostile Crosstalk of –70 dB @ 5 MHz
Reset Pin Allows Disabling of All Outputs (Connected
Through a Capacitor to Ground Provides “Power-On”
Reset Capability)
100-Lead LQFP Package (14 mm 3 14 mm)
